Henning Berg Invites Young Players to First Team Training

Henning Berg shows his belief in young talent by letting them train with the first team.

The Norwegian coach brings in 4-5 players from the Academies for men’s team training each week. His aim is to assess their skills and help them gain experience.

This Monday, more young players joined than usual, showing a strong focus on talent development.

It’s important to mention that Chrysis Evangelou, a promising player close to the first team, missed training due to an injury and is still sidelined.

Berg’s approach shows OMONOIA’s commitment to nurturing its own talent, building a strong future for the team.

From left (as seen in the photo)

  • Thanasis Panagiotou: 2008, central defender, left-footed, U19
  • Michalis Antoniou: 2008, left back, U19
  • Gabriel Psilogennis: 2007, midfielder, U19
  • Vladimir Savva: 2008, attacking midfielder, U19
  • Ilarionas Groutas: 2007, central defender, left-footed, U19
  • Christos Kittos: 2008, left back, U19
  • Ilias Stylianou: 2008, midfielder, U19
  • Christian Andrew Michael: 2008, forward, U19
